>> Hi Arnau,
>> in my opinion GSTAT is angry because in GOC-DB the nodes lfclhcb and
>> lfcatlas are registered as "LFC" instead of "Local-LFC", so it
>> doesn't find the GlueServicetype of a "central" lfc If you change
>> the "node-type", the alarms should disappear
